This is a 52-year-old man who had recurrent chest pain for 2 hours, and at that time he mistakenly thought it was a stomach problem, and he came to the hospital after taking stomach medicine that could not relieve it.

He was an out-of-town truck driver, and after his colleagues took him to the emergency room, the doctor quickly checked an electrocardiogram and found that it was an acute myocardial infarction.

The emergency doctor immediately opened the green channel of the "chest pain center", let the patient take "aspirin, ticagrelor, rosuvastatin" and other first-aid drugs, and activated the catheterization laboratory to prepare for emergency surgery.

However, the patient felt that he was young and in good health, and did not want surgery or thrombolysis.

Judging from the electrocardiogram, this is a large-scale myocardial infarction, and the location of the blockage is very dangerous, and death may occur at any time.

The cardiologist communicated and explained for a long time, and called his wife who was out of town, but fortunately, after his lover understood, he thought about it for a long time, and finally made up his mind to operate.

At this time, nearly an hour had passed since he went to the emergency room, and ECG monitoring could see multiple premature ventricular contractions and low blood pressure, which was a very dangerous signal.

Some people will ask: is it so dangerous or emergency surgery? Aren't you afraid? Can I do it again when my condition is stable? Yes, it is dangerous, and doctors are not willing to take risks, but if you do not rush to emergency surgery, the patient may die immediately, and there is no chance to wait until the condition is stable, and there is only a chance to survive after opening the blood vessels as soon as possible.

The imaging revealed occlusion of the left anterior descending artery, a blood vessel that supplies most of the blood flow to the left heart, and is extremely honorable.

In recent years, due to the prevalence of unhealthy lifestyles, the incidence of cardiovascular diseases in mainland China has continued to rise, and it is estimated that there are currently 330 million patients with cardiovascular diseases, and 3.09 million deaths due to cardiovascular diseases in 2005 increased to 4.58 million in 2020.

It is no wonder that there are more and more patients with myocardial infarction, and they are getting younger and younger, and the number of patients with myocardial infarction in their 20s and 30s is increasing every year.

Both patients have 5 habits tonight: high blood pressure has not taken medicine for many years, smokes for a long time, does not like to eat vegetables, eats salty and greasy, and often stays up late to drive or socialize.

According to statistics, in 2022, there will be 1.034 million hospitalized patients with myocardial infarction in mainland China, of which 2.3% will be combined with cardiac arrest, and the in-hospital mortality rate will be 4.3%.

This is only for hospitalized patients, and this also means that a significant number of patients with heart attacks die suddenly before they have time to reach the hospital.

So is there a way to prevent it? Of course, as long as the following 6 points are usually achieved, the probability of cardiovascular accidents will be greatly reduced.

1. Pay attention to heat and cold prevention

High temperature will lead to an increase in cardiovascular mortality of 12.95%, although autumn, but the weather in the south is still relatively hot, the temperature of the air conditioner should not be too low, regularly open the window for ventilation, to properly replenish water, if there is no heart failure, about 1500 ml or more per day, to avoid excessive blood viscosity.

The northern region may already be relatively cold, or the temperature difference is very large, and the cold will also lead to a great increase in the probability of cardiovascular and cerebrovascular accidents. 2. Exercise appropriately and do what you can

It is recommended to exercise more than 5 times a week, about 30 minutes of aerobic exercise each time, brisk walking, jogging, and swimming are all good choices.

3. Maintain good living habits

To achieve a balanced diet, low-salt and low-fat diet, eat more foods rich in dietary fiber and vitamins, such as vegetables, fruits, coarse grains, etc., and also appropriately supplement poultry, eggs, and milk.

4. Quit smoking, limit alcohol, and stay away from secondhand smoke

Smoking will lead to damage to the endothelium of blood vessels, prone to plaque, and narrowing of blood vessels.

5. Maintain a good mindset and sleep

Nowadays, everyone has a lot of pressure in work and life, which is also a reason for the high incidence of cardiovascular disease, when you are emotionally stressed, you can stand naturally, close your eyes, and take deep breaths to help relax and relax.

6. Take medication regularly on time to control blood pressure, blood sugar, blood lipids, etc

Coronary heart disease is closely related to these high-risk factors, and many patients we meet with myocardial infarction usually do not have regular treatment, resulting in myocardial infarction, so we must take medication regularly under the guidance of a doctor.

In the event of a heart attack, how should I receive first aid?

1. Don't panic, rest on the spot, maintain a comfortable position, sit and lie down, don't believe in the so-called "coughing hard to save yourself", "slapping and jumping hard to flush the blood clot away", which will increase myocardial oxygen consumption and accelerate death.

2. Immediately call the 120 emergency number, grasp the golden 120 minutes, choose the nearest chest pain center for treatment, and don't be reluctant to seek far. Clinically, many patients with myocardial infarction have collapsed on inappropriate transport routes.

3. If you consider angina pectoris and your blood pressure is normal, you can try to take nitroglycerin and so on under the guidance of a doctor.

As for whether to take aspirin after chest pain, etc., it is necessary to have the professional judgment and guidance of a doctor.

4. If the patient has cardiac arrest, cardiopulmonary resuscitation should be carried out immediately, if you don't understand, you can call 120 for help, and actively rescue under the guidance of the doctor.

5. After arriving at the hospital, please do not hesitate if you have the opportunity to perform emergency PCI surgery or thrombolysis. At present, both domestic and foreign guidelines strongly recommend emergency stent surgery as the first choice.

It is precisely because of the current vascular recanalization techniques such as stents and thrombolysis that the in-hospital mortality rate of myocardial infarction has dropped to about 4% as mentioned above, compared with more than 30% in the past.
